Apart from the last picture, where it is probably really šentjanževka, the others are pegaste krčnice, as they have rounded sepals and many black dots on the underside of the petals. Pegaste krčnice are more characteristic of the montane and subalpine belt, while šentjanževka prefers lower altitudes, definitely below the forest line.
